a cylindrical container can hold about 1256 cubic inches of water. the diameter of the cylinder is 10 inches long.
djyliett [7]

Answer: 16 inches

Step-by-step explanation:

Complete question

(A cylindrical container can hold about 1256 cubic inches of water. the diameter of the cylinder is 10 inches long. approximate the height if the cylinder to the nearest inch . Use 3.14 to approximate the value of pi)

Volume of a cylinder = 3.14 * r² * h

r = radius of the cylinder

H = height of the cylinder

Pi = 3.142

Radius = diameter/ 2

R = 10/2 = 5 inches

1256 = 3.14 * 5² * h

1256 = 78.5h

Divide both sides by 78.5 to get h,

H = 1256 / 78.5 = 16 inches

The height of the cylinder is 16 inches
